Some one asked for a bit more detail. Hope it helps

A layer of polythene is stuck to the base board with carpet tape.
Then the bagging tape is set around the edge.
The moulds have had plenty of release wax .



All the parts are then cut to shape

So a mix of micro fibres and epoxy is laid down first. Let this go tacky.



Then the layers of cloth and wetted out



Followed by the peal ply



Followed by the air bleed fabric



Then the top layer of polythene is laid down onto the bagging tape and the vac pipe taped in.
It takes a bit of rubbing to seal this lot down. Then turn on the vac pump




So after its all dry I removed them..
A couple of hours with a file or two and here is the result ready for a coat of primer.





Not to bad me thinks. Will look ok when painted up I hope. Just need to make the working hatch next and final trim to shape when I get the fuz back

Offline Cornish Pixie wrote Re: Balsa USA Fokker DV11 1/3rd scale on March 16, 2012, 18:40:40 PM
The white is from Ian
The black is Emulsion from a test pot.
The brown is wood stain.
Sealed up with a coat of Diamond Hard Varnish.
